- * StreamRpcChannelTest.cpp
- * Test fixture for the StreamRpcChannel class
- * Copyright (C) 2005-2008 Simon Newton
- */
- #include <cppunit/extensions/HelperMacros.h>
- #include <google/protobuf/stubs/common.h>
- #include <string>
- #include "ola/io/SelectServer.h"
- #include "ola/network/Socket.h"
- #include "common/rpc/StreamRpcChannel.h"
- #include "common/rpc/SimpleRpcController.h"
- #include "common/rpc/TestService.pb.h"
- using google::protobuf::NewCallback;
- using ola::io::LoopbackDescriptor;
- using ola::io::SelectServer;
- using ola::rpc::EchoReply;
- using ola::rpc::EchoRequest;
- using ola::rpc::STREAMING_NO_RESPONSE;
- using ola::rpc::SimpleRpcController;
- using ola::rpc::StreamRpcChannel;
- using ola::rpc::TestService;
- using ola::rpc::TestService_Stub;
- using std::string;
- /*
- * Our test implementation
- */
- class TestServiceImpl: public TestService {
- public:
- explicit TestServiceImpl(SelectServer *ss): m_ss(ss) {}
- ~TestServiceImpl() {}
- void Echo(::google::protobuf::RpcController* controller,
- const EchoRequest* request,
- EchoReply* response,
- ::google::protobuf::Closure* done);
- void FailedEcho(::google::protobuf::RpcController* controller,
- const EchoRequest* request,
- EchoReply* response,
- ::google::protobuf::Closure* done);
- void Stream(::google::protobuf::RpcController* controller,
- const ::ola::rpc::EchoRequest* request,
- STREAMING_NO_RESPONSE* response,
- ::google::protobuf::Closure* done);
- private:
- SelectServer *m_ss;
- };
- class StreamRpcChannelTest: public CppUnit::TestFixture {
- CPPUNIT_TEST_SUITE(StreamRpcChannelTest);
- CPPUNIT_TEST(testEcho);
- CPPUNIT_TEST(testFailedEcho);
- CPPUNIT_TEST(testStreamRequest);
- CPPUNIT_TEST_SUITE_END();
- public:
- void setUp();
- void tearDown();
- void testEcho();
- void testFailedEcho();
- void testStreamRequest();
- void EchoComplete();
- void FailedEchoComplete();
- private:
- int m_fd_pair[2];
- SimpleRpcController m_controller;
- EchoRequest m_request;
- EchoReply m_reply;
- TestService_Stub *m_stub;
- SelectServer m_ss;
- TestServiceImpl *m_service;
- StreamRpcChannel *m_channel;
- LoopbackDescriptor *m_socket;
- };
- CPPUNIT_TEST_SUITE_REGISTRATION(StreamRpcChannelTest);
- void TestServiceImpl::Echo(::google::protobuf::RpcController* controller,
- const EchoRequest* request,
- EchoReply* response,
- ::google::protobuf::Closure* done) {
- response->set_data(request->data());
- done->Run();
- (void) controller;
- (void) request;
- }
- void TestServiceImpl::FailedEcho(::google::protobuf::RpcController* controller,
- const EchoRequest* request,
- EchoReply* response,
- ::google::protobuf::Closure* done) {
- controller->SetFailed("Error");
- done->Run();
- (void) request;
- (void) response;
- }
- void TestServiceImpl::Stream(::google::protobuf::RpcController* controller,
- const ::ola::rpc::EchoRequest* request,
- STREAMING_NO_RESPONSE* response,
- ::google::protobuf::Closure* done) {
- CPPUNIT_ASSERT(!controller);
- CPPUNIT_ASSERT(!response);
- CPPUNIT_ASSERT(!done);
- CPPUNIT_ASSERT(request);
- CPPUNIT_ASSERT_EQUAL(string("foo"), request->data());
- m_ss->Terminate();
- }
- void StreamRpcChannelTest::setUp() {
- m_socket = new LoopbackDescriptor();
- m_socket->Init();
- m_service = new TestServiceImpl(&m_ss);
- m_channel = new StreamRpcChannel(m_service, m_socket);
- m_ss.AddReadDescriptor(m_socket);
- m_stub = new TestService_Stub(m_channel);
- }
- void StreamRpcChannelTest::tearDown() {
- m_ss.RemoveReadDescriptor(m_socket);
- delete m_socket;
- delete m_stub;
- delete m_channel;
- delete m_service;
- }
- void StreamRpcChannelTest::EchoComplete() {
- m_ss.Terminate();
- CPPUNIT_ASSERT(!m_controller.Failed());
- CPPUNIT_ASSERT_EQUAL(m_reply.data(), m_request.data());
- }
- void StreamRpcChannelTest::FailedEchoComplete() {
- m_ss.Terminate();
- CPPUNIT_ASSERT(m_controller.Failed());
- }
- /*
- * Check that we can call the echo method in the TestServiceImpl.
- */
- void StreamRpcChannelTest::testEcho() {
- m_request.set_data("foo");
- m_stub->Echo(&m_controller,
- &m_request,
- &m_reply,
- NewCallback(this, &StreamRpcChannelTest::EchoComplete));
- m_ss.Run();
- }
- /*
- * Check that method that fail return correctly
- */
- void StreamRpcChannelTest::testFailedEcho() {
- m_request.set_data("foo");
- m_stub->FailedEcho(
- &m_controller,
- &m_request,
- &m_reply,
- NewCallback(this, &StreamRpcChannelTest::FailedEchoComplete));
- m_ss.Run();
- }
- /*
- * Check stream requests work
- */
- void StreamRpcChannelTest::testStreamRequest() {
- m_request.set_data("foo");
- m_stub->Stream(NULL, &m_request, NULL, NULL);
- m_ss.Run();
- }
